Department Department of Radiology
Introduction Established in 1954, the Department of Radiology succeeded in Korea¡¯s first cardiac angiography in 1959 and studied gastric emptying and motility in the 1960s and achieving animal experiments for radiation hazard in 1970¡¯s. With the introduction of CT, ultrasonography, and angiography machines in the early 1980s, the department has devoted to interventional radiology as well as images and put emphasis on CTguided fine-needle biopsy (Korea¡¯s first also), biliary and vascular intervention, and developed into interventional neuroradiology (endovascular neurosurgery) in 1990¡¯s. As installing PACS (digital image process and display) in the early 1990¡¯s the department completely equipped with sole digital machines.
Continuously expanded, the department now possesses four MR units (three 3 tesla machines), six CTs, four angiographic units, and more than ten ultrasound machines. Now it has fourteen faculty members and around 120 radiographers studying 651,749 cases of 325,711 patients in the year 2012.​
